About SecurityScorecard
SecurityScorecard is the global leader in cybersecurity ratings, with over 12 million companies continuously rated, operating in 64 countries. Founded in 2013 by security and risk experts Dr. Alex Yampolskiy and Sam Kassoumeh and funded by world-class investors, SecurityScorecard’s patented rating technology is used by over 25,000 organizations for self-monitoring, third-party risk management, board reporting, and cyber insurance underwriting; making all organizations more resilient by allowing them to easily find and fix cybersecurity risks across their digital footprint.

About The Team
SecurityScorecard is hiring a Field Sales Director, Federal to drive new business across the full U.S. Federal landscape — including DoW, Defense agencies, Federal Civilian departments, and other government entities.
This is a high-impact, quota-carrying role responsible for expanding our footprint across the Federal ecosystem by aligning SecurityScorecard's solutions to agency cybersecurity, risk management, and compliance initiatives (e.g., CMMC, FISMA, Zero Trust, supply chain risk). You'll operate as a strategic seller, owning your territory end-to-end while partnering with internal stakeholders and channel partners to drive pipeline, close deals, and scale long-term growth.
What You Will Do
- Develop and execute territory and account strategies aligned to Federal agency priorities across DoD, Defense agencies, and Civilian departments, including cybersecurity posture management, third-party risk, and Zero Trust initiatives
- Build and manage a pipeline of qualified opportunities across assigned Federal accounts
- Engage and establish credibility with key stakeholders including CIO, CISO, Risk, Procurement, and Program leadership across both Defense and Civilian environments
- Translate agency mission priorities and compliance drivers (CMMC, FISMA, NIST, Zero Trust) into compelling SecurityScorecard use cases
- Drive full-cycle sales from prospecting through close, consistently exceeding pipeline, booking, and revenue targets
- Partner cross-functionally with Marketing, Customer Success, and Solutions Engineering to drive demand generation and customer outcomes
- Leverage and expand relationships with channel partners (VARs, GSIs, MSSPs) to accelerate deal cycles and market penetration across the Federal ecosystem
- Lead strategic account planning, forecasting, and pipeline management with high accuracy
- Coordinate regional marketing and field activities tied to pipeline generation and ROI
- Represent the voice of the Federal customer internally to influence product and GTM strategy.
Basic Qualifications
- Based in the Greater Washington, D.C. / Northern Virginia / Maryland metro area
- 10+ years of enterprise sales experience, including selling into U.S. Federal agencies across DoD and/or Civilian verticals
- Demonstrated success exceeding pipeline generation, bookings, and revenue targets
- Proven ability to build relationships with senior government stakeholders (CIO/CISO level) across Defense and/or Civilian agencies
- Experience selling cybersecurity, SaaS, or risk management solutions into Federal accounts
- Familiarity with Federal procurement processes (e.g., GSA schedules, IDIQs, OTAs, FedRAMP environments)
Additional Qualifications
- Strong understanding of Federal cybersecurity frameworks and mandates across DoD and Civilian contexts (CMMC, FISMA, NIST, Zero Trust, supply chain risk)
- Experience driving large, complex deals (>$1M ARR) within Federal agencies
- Track record of partnering effectively with system integrators and resellers in the public sector ecosystem
- Experience operating in a high-growth or startup environment, driving new market penetration
- Ability to communicate cybersecurity value in terms of mission impact, compliance, and risk reduction
